Output 34d08c4d351d85767d5115ca05a63c9be4b3453ecd53dfdb6b0068cb7bd7054c:0

value
1008118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729620a5cebe882bc93150fddfa4cfba451765b1 OP_EQUAL
address
3C8toTQVaq3smA5VCDyHyv8zxRyBueiZde
transaction
34d08c4d351d85767d5115ca05a63c9be4b3453ecd53dfdb6b0068cb7bd7054c
confirmations
279444
spent
true